Robert Lewandowski hoping Barcelona can learn from Dortmund ‘wake-up call’

Robert Lewandowski feels Barcelona can learn from their defeat to Dortmund in the Champions League and says the loss may be the wake-up call the team needed.

Dortmund ran out 3-1 winners on Tuesday night in the second leg of their quarter-final tie in the Champions League but it’s Barcelona who progress 5-3 on aggregate.

The defeat is Barcelona’s first in 2025 and ends a great unbeaten run from Hansi Flick’s team. However, Lewandowski knows it wasn’t the worst game in the world to lose.
